CHOIR HONOUR

The choir of All Saints, Little Totham, and St Peter's Church, Goldhanger, is now 15 strong, comprising five men and ten women.

To their delight they have been invited to sing at three services in Norwich Cathedral.

They will join St Nicholas's choir from Witham at choral evensong on Saturday, October 20, as well as Sung Eucharist and Choral Evensong the following day.

Partners and supporters will accompany them on the trip.

St Peter's choir from Great Totham will take over duties at All Saints during the weekend.
